About the Committee

The Data Centre & Data Centre Interconnection Committee is the FTTH Council Europe's newest committee, established to reflect the Council's expanded remit across data centres and the fibre infrastructure that connects them.

The Committee's current work programme includes a report on hollow core fibre (HCF) and multi-core fibre (MCF), a DCI market study developed with the Board, and updates to the Market Panorama to capture the Council's broader scope. Alongside this, the Committee is developing a programme of educational webinars for members on AI-driven data centres, covering the underlying drivers and market trends, internal data centre architectures and wider interconnection architectures.

The Committee also leads the data centre and interconnection content at the annual FTTH Conference, shaping several hours of programming across the full breadth of the Council's expanded remit.

Panel 8 - Two Markets, Two Paths: Fibre Lessons from Germany & Italy

Germany and Italy represent two very different approaches to fibre deployment in Europe—shaped by distinct market structures, regulatory environments, and investment models. Understanding these differences is essential for anyone navigating fibre strategy at scale.

This panel will compare the evolution of both markets, examining how policy choices, competitive dynamics, and commercial models have influenced rollout speed, coverage, and adoption. It will highlight what has driven success, where challenges remain, and why outcomes have diverged despite similar long-term connectivity goals.

With a strong focus on practical, transferable lessons, the discussion will explore how insights from Germany and Italy can inform decision-making in other European fibre markets—covering implications for operators, investors, and policymakers looking to accelerate sustainable full-fibre growth.
